Usability 101 – What Are The Basics?

To market effectively to web consumers requires marketing practitioners to have an increasing understanding of the core elements of usability.

A basic model of usability developed by Davis in the 1980′s is the Technology Acceptance Model (TAM) – (some 62,000 Google search results!). Based on years of research on what influences an individuals propensity to accept or adopt a technology, it’s basics parameters are still fundamental today.
